Manchester United boss Ole Gunnar Solskjaer has three midfield targets for next transfer window

Manchester United are still interested in signing Jude Bellingham, Jack Grealish and James Maddison when the transfer window reopens, according to Sky Sports reporter Kaveh Solhekol. Birmingham City's 16-year-old sensation Bellingham was shown around the United training ground last month. Aston Villa captain Grealish and Leicester City star Maddison are also linked with United after fine seasons for their respective clubs.
